Transaction f95586ecad7e9fe823caa6be497340b2b0da2c44afab5000e8c407d50f18e631

block
1fc2527e7c399b65a97623fc206ed3b11efc32b2bd70caccb85ebe93ffb5b3e6

1 Input

23 Outputs